ImgJoinUtil图片拼接工具类
import com.sun.image.codec.jpeg.JPEGCodec;
import com.sun.image.codec.jpeg.JPEGImageEncoder;
import com.xiangweihui.core.bean.imgJoin.ImgBean;
import com.xiangweihui.core.bean.imgJoin.TextBean;
import com.xiangweihui.core.util.system.UniqId;
import javax.imageio.ImageIO;
import java.awt.*;
import java.awt.image.BufferedImage;
import java.io.File;
import java.io.FileOutputStream;
import java.io.IOException;
import java.math.BigDecimal;
import java.util.ArrayList;
import java.util.List;
/**
* @Project xiangweihui
* @PackageName com.xiangweihui.core.util
* @ClassName ImgJoinUtil
* @Author jiahong.xing
* @Date 2019/6/17 13:32
* @Description 图片拼接工具类
*/
public class ImgJoinUtil {
public static File createColorImg(final int width, final int height, final Color color, List imgBeanList, List textBeanList) {
return createColorImg(width, height, color, null, imgBeanList, textBeanList);
}
/**
* @param width 图片宽度
* @param height 图片高度
* @param color 背景颜色
* @param outPath 输出路径,可为空
* @param imgBeanList 图片列表
* @param textBeanList 文字列表
* @return
*/
public static File createColorImg(final int width, final int height, final Color color, String outPath, List imgBeanList, List textBeanList) {
if (width < 1 || height < 1) {
return null;
}
File file = null;
FileOutputStream out = null;
try {
//构造一个类型为预定义图像类型之一的 BufferedImage。 宽度为第一只的宽度,高度为各个图片高度之和
BufferedImage bufferedImage = createColorImg(width, height, color);
//创建输出流
if (StringUtils.isNotEmpty(outPath)) {
file = new File(outPath);
} else {
file = File.createTempFile("joimImg", UniqId.getUid() + ".jpg");
}
out = new FileOutputStream(file);
//进行图片的处理
if (CollectionUtils.isNotEmptyCollection(imgBeanList)) {
Graphics graphics = bufferedImage.createGraphics();
for (ImgBean imgBean : imgBeanList) {
if (null == imgBean.getFile()) {
continue;
}
BufferedImage image = ImageIO.read(imgBean.getFile());
int img_height = imgBean.getImg_height();
int img_width = imgBean.getImg_width();
if (img_height < 1) {
img_height = image.getHeight();
}
if (img_width < 1) {
img_width = image.getWidth();
}
graphics.drawImage(image, imgBean.getLeft(), imgBean.getTop(), img_width, img_height, null);
}
// 释放此图形的上下文以及它使用的所有系统资源。
graphics.dispose();
}
//进行文字的处理
if (CollectionUtils.isNotEmptyCollection(textBeanList)) {
for (TextBean textBean : textBeanList) {
if (StringUtils.isEmpty(textBean.getText())) {
continue;
}
//字体
Graphics2D graphics2D = bufferedImage.createGraphics();
Font font = null;
if (null != textBean.getFont()) {
font = textBean.getFont();
} else {
font = FontUtil.getDefaultFont();
}
graphics2D.setFont(font);
graphics2D.setColor(textBean.getColor());
graphics2D.setRenderingHint(RenderingHints.KEY_ANTIALIASING, RenderingHints.VALUE_ANTIALIAS_ON);
//获取字符高度
int strHeight = graphics2D.getFontMetrics().getHeight();
//得到文字的长度
int max_length = FontUtil.getStringLength(font, textBean.getText());
//判断是否控制了文字长度
if (textBean.getMax_width() > 0 && max_length > textBean.getMax_width()) {
//初始高度
int inity = textBean.getTop();
//循环得到字符串的长度
String newStr = textBean.getText();
//如果不是最后的长度
while (!FontUtil.isMaxStr(font, newStr, textBean.getMax_width())) {
String istr = FontUtil.strSplitMaxLenth(font, newStr, textBean.getMax_width());
//直接绘制
graphics2D.drawString(istr, textBean.getLeft(), inity);
//完成后,进行初始化
newStr = newStr.replaceFirst(istr, "");
//高度再次重构
inity += strHeight + textBean.getLine_height();
}
//最后补一次
if (newStr.length() > 0) {
graphics2D.drawString(newStr, textBean.getLeft(), inity);
}
} else {
graphics2D.drawString(textBean.getText(), textBean.getLeft(), textBean.getTop());
}
// 释放此图形的上下文以及它使用的所有系统资源。
graphics2D.dispose();
}
}
//将绘制的图像生成至输出流
JPEGImageEncoder encoder = JPEGCodec.createJPEGEncoder(out);
encoder.encode(bufferedImage);
} catch (Exception e) {
e.printStackTrace();
} finally {
try {
//关闭输出流
if (null != out) {
out.close();
}
} catch (IOException e) {
e.printStackTrace();
}
}
return file;
}
//创建一张底图
public static BufferedImage createColorImg(int width, int height, Color color) {
//创建一个图片缓冲区
BufferedImage bufferedImage = new BufferedImage(width, height, BufferedImage.TYPE_INT_BGR);
//获取图片处理对象
Graphics graphics = bufferedImage.getGraphics();
//填充背景色
graphics.setColor(color);
graphics.fillRect(0, 0, width, height);
return bufferedImage;
}
}
会默认根据大小和底色创建一个底图,然后根据根据各种图片、文字等进行拼接,最终生成一张大图片,非常高清,支持超高分辨率
